What to expect during your TMJ Botox appointment.

Consultation and examination

The first step is a consultation where we’ll discuss your symptoms and medical history. I’ll assess the severity of your TMJ issues by checking for signs of muscle tightness, jaw alignment, and any other concerns. Based on your evaluation, we’ll create a treatment plan tailored to your needs.

The Botox injection process

The Botox injections for TMJ themselves are quick and minimally invasive. During the procedure, I’ll use a fine needle to inject small amounts of Botox into the muscles around your jaw. Most of my patients say they feel little to no discomfort—just a quick pinch, and that’s it.

In fact, Samantha, one of my patients who was nervous about getting Botox injections, said it felt like a tiny pinch and nothing more. The whole process usually takes about 10-15 minutes, so it’s easy to fit into a lunch break or a busy schedule.

After the appointment

One of the best things about Botox for TMJ is the minimal downtime. Most people can return to their normal activities right away. However, I always tell my patients to avoid massaging the injected areas or lying down for about four hours to help the Botox settle.
